LTF’eren, who was found guilty of attempted murder of two policemen and sentenced to 20 years in prison and deportation for ever, anchor byrettens judgment.

He will be dismissed.

This was stated by his counsel, attorney David Neutzsky-Wulff.

the district Court found it proven that the 20-year-old member of the Loyal to Familia drove the scooter, which was shot against a civil police car in Mjølnerparken in outer Nørrebro. It was hit by at least five shots.

One of the officers in the court explained that the scooter stopped five feet from them, then the passenger looked directly into the car, pulled a gun and pointed at them. The officers threw themselves down in the car and heard about five shots.

the Case was during the previous years of gang-related conflict between the LTF and the Brothas that cost three people their lives. It is the police view that the perpetrators mistook the police officers with rival gang members.

in addition to drabsforsøget on the two police officers was the 20-year-old convicted of three cases of possession of weapons and threats.

the Court found that all the incidents, except the two cases of threats, was a part of the bandekonflikten. Therefore, he was convicted after the special bandeparagraf, which allows to increase the penalty by up to double.

Three other members of the Loyal to Familia was acquitted in the case.
